Lying on the residency attestation form is a class 4 misdemeanor. Sounds scary. Look it up - max punishment is a $250 fine. No one is going to risk a $250 fine for their kids education, right? Also, residency is a notoriously slippery concept. It’s not easy to disprove residency. |

VDOE School Profile pages show this information about the learning climate Langley: Behaviors that Impede Academic Progress - 8 Behaviors related to School Operations - 22 Relationship Behaviors without Physical Harm - 19 Behaviors of a Safety Concern - 31 Behaviors that Endanger the Health, Safety, or Welfare of Self or Others - 21 Herndon: Behaviors that Impede Academic Progress - 506 Behaviors related to School Operations - 496 Relationship Behaviors without Physical Harm - 375 Behaviors of a Safety Concern - 204 Behaviors that Endanger the Health, Safety, or Welfare of Self or Others - 36 |
